#418067 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#418067 is composed of 25.5% red, 50.2% green and 40.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 49.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 19.5% yellow and 49.8% black. It has a hue angle of 156.2 degrees, a saturation of 32.6% and a lightness of 37.8%. #418067 color hex could be obtained by blending #82ffce with #000100.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

Shades and Tints of #418067

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060b09 is the darkest color, while #fdfefe is the lightest one.

Tones of #418067

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5f6261 is the less saturated color, while #06bb73 is the most saturated one.
